XAMPP adalah singkatan dari “X” (baca sebagai “cross”), “Apache”, “MySQL”, “PHP”, dan “Perl”. Ini adalah paket perangkat lunak sumber terbuka yang dirancang untuk memudahkan pengembangan dan pengujian aplikasi web secara lokal. XAMPP menyediakan lingkungan server web lengkap yang dapat dijalankan di komputer lokal Anda. Ini termasuk server Apache HTTP, database MySQL, serta interpreter bahasa pemrograman PHP dan Perl. XAMPP sangat populer di kalangan pengembang web karena memungkinkan mereka untuk membuat dan menguji aplikasi web secara lokal sebelum mereka menerapkannya ke server yang sebenarnya di internet. Ini juga memungkinkan pengguna untuk mencoba dan mempelajari teknologi web tanpa perlu mengatur server secara manual.
Fungsi XAMPP
- Mengembangkan Aplikasi Web secara Lokal
- XAMPP memungkinkan pengembang web untuk membuat dan menguji aplikasi web secara lokal di komputer mereka sendiri sebelum merilisnya ke server produksi di internet. Ini membantu dalam pengembangan dan debugging aplikasi sebelum diluncurkan secara publik.
- XAMPP memungkinkan pengembang web untuk membuat dan menguji aplikasi web secara lokal di komputer mereka sendiri sebelum merilisnya ke server produksi di internet. Ini membantu dalam pengembangan dan debugging aplikasi sebelum diluncurkan secara publik.
- Pengelolaan Database
- XAMPP menyertakan server database MySQL, yang memungkinkan pengguna untuk membuat, mengelola, dan menguji basis data mereka secara lokal. Ini penting untuk pengembangan aplikasi web yang membutuhkan penyimpanan dan pengelolaan data.
- XAMPP menyertakan server database MySQL, yang memungkinkan pengguna untuk membuat, mengelola, dan menguji basis data mereka secara lokal. Ini penting untuk pengembangan aplikasi web yang membutuhkan penyimpanan dan pengelolaan data.
- Menjalankan Server Web Lokal
- XAMPP menyertakan server web Apache HTTP, yang memungkinkan pengguna untuk menjalankan situs web dan aplikasi web di komputer lokal mereka tanpa perlu mengandalkan server web eksternal.
- XAMPP menyertakan server web Apache HTTP, yang memungkinkan pengguna untuk menjalankan situs web dan aplikasi web di komputer lokal mereka tanpa perlu mengandalkan server web eksternal.
- Dukungan untuk Bahasa Pemrograman
- XAMPP mendukung bahasa pemrograman seperti PHP dan Perl, yang memungkinkan pengguna untuk mengembangkan aplikasi web dinamis dan interaktif.
- XAMPP mendukung bahasa pemrograman seperti PHP dan Perl, yang memungkinkan pengguna untuk mengembangkan aplikasi web dinamis dan interaktif.
- Lingkungan Pengembangan yang Terisolasi
- XAMPP menyediakan lingkungan pengembangan yang terisolasi di komputer lokal, yang berarti pengguna dapat mencoba berbagai konfigurasi dan setup tanpa mempengaruhi server produksi atau infrastruktur web lainnya.
- XAMPP menyediakan lingkungan pengembangan yang terisolasi di komputer lokal, yang berarti pengguna dapat mencoba berbagai konfigurasi dan setup tanpa mempengaruhi server produksi atau infrastruktur web lainnya.
- Pelatihan dan Pembelajaran
- XAMPP juga dapat digunakan sebagai alat pembelajaran untuk mempelajari teknologi web dan pengembangan aplikasi, karena memungkinkan pengguna untuk mencoba berbagai teknologi dan konsep tanpa perlu mengatur server secara manual.
Cara menginstall XAMPP di windows
- Unduh XAMPP: Kunjungi situs web resmi XAMPP (https://www.apachefriends.org/index.html) dan unduh versi terbaru yang sesuai dengan sistem operasi Windows.
- Jalankan Instalator: Setelah mengunduh file instalasi, buka file tersebut dan jalankan program instalasi XAMPP.
- Pilih Komponen yang Ingin Diinstal: Selama proses instalasi, akan diminta untuk memilih komponen yang ingin diinstal. Komponen-komponen umum termasuk Apache, MySQL, PHP, dan phpMyAdmin.
- Pilih Lokasi Instalasi: memilih lokasi default atau menentukan lokasi instalasi yang berbeda.
- Selesaikan Instalasi: Setelah memilih komponen dan lokasi instalasi, lanjutkan dengan proses instalasi. Tunggu hingga proses instalasi selesai.
- Mulai XAMPP Control Panel: Setelah instalasi selesai. Gunakan panel kontrol ini untuk memulai dan menghentikan layanan seperti Apache dan MySQL.
- Konfigurasi: Setelah XAMPP diinstal, mungkin perlu melakukan beberapa konfigurasi tambahan tergantung pada kebutuhan. Misalnya, mengkonfigurasi Apache untuk memuat proyek web.
- Tes Instalasi: Untuk memastikan XAMPP telah diinstal dengan benar, buka browser web dan ketikkan “http://localhost” di bilah alamat.